A.J.C. RACE MEETING

HOME MADE WINS STEEPLES CROWN AREA TAKES THE EXETER EDENHALL RUNS A SECOND. By Telegraph—Press Assn.—Copyright. Rec. 5.5 p.m. Sydney, June 14. The chief results at the A.J.C. meeting to-day were: — SECOND HURDLES. Of 600 govs. About two miles. SONGIFT, H. Balcombe’s br.g.. by Trillion —Irish Kate, aged, 11.0 (Giles) 1 ROSSGOLE. 9.4 (Harris) 2j OSTENTATION. T. L. Rutledge’s b.g., by Limelight—Grand Duchess, syrs, 9.0 (Baker) 3 Eight started. Won by five lengths, with a length between second and thjrd. Doctor Grace was fourth. Time, 3min. 381 sec FLYING HANDICAP. Of 500 sovs. Six furlongs. ’ 'JISAN, A. J. Matthews’ b.g.. by Valais—Lady San, aged. 9.9 (Pike), ..’ 1 VERTOY, 7.3 (Pratt) 2 CASQUE D’OR. Mrs. W. M. Gollan’s blk.g., by Roesendale —Naroama, 4yrs, 8.6 (Cooke) 3 Ten started. Won by a length..with half a head between second and third. Time, Imin. lljsec. A.J.C. STEEPLECHASE. Of 2000 sovs. About three miles. HOME MADE (ex-N.Z,), A. B. Cowell’s b.g., by Thurnham —Housewife, aged, 10.0 (Harri") 1 EGO. H. S. Thompson’s-b.g.. by Cooltrim,—Appoline, Gyrs, 9.0 (Conaghan) 2 PPINCE ARIM. J. Phoenix, b.g.. by Arim —Eppitnax, aged. 10.5 (Baker) .’...... 3 ■ Also started—-Grosvenor,' Tressady Rock, Burraform, Kinross, Rearguard. The early running was made by Kinross, with Home Made, Ego. Prince Arim and Burraform the nearest attendants. Grosvenor came down and the jockey, Carter, was injured. Kinross fell back after going two miles. Ego led over the last jump from ' Home Made. The latter lasted longest and in a desperate finish gained the verdict by a neck, while Prince Arim, six lengths back, was third. Then followed Kinross, Rearguard and Burraform. Time, Ginin. 252se€. ' WINTER STAKES. ' 'Of GOO sovs. One mile and five - ■ furlongs. FRANCES CYLLENE. - "J. Constable’s” br.m.,. by Cyllene More —Mv Lady, Gyrs, 7.11 (Denham) 1 EDENHALL (ex-N.Z.),» T.' C. TrantWein’s b.g., by Quin Abbey—Toll Gate, aged, 7.7 (Pratt) 2 INDUCEMENT, R. Miller’s br.g., by Magpie —Prize Money, syrs, 7-12 (Bartie) 3 Fourteen started. Won by a length, with a length between second and third. Time, 2nin. 46sec, EXETER HANDICAP. Of 500 sovs. One mile. CROWN AREA (ex-N.Z.), b.g. by Acre —Moorefield, Gyrs, 9.12 . ./Bartie) 1 AORANGI, T. C. Trautwein’s br.g., by Newmarket—Poor Clarice, j aged, 9.9, (Maher) ... 2 F. A. Moses’ ch.g., by Poitrel—Contone, aged, 9.2 (Davidson) 3 Seventeen started. Won by a head, with a length between second and third. Time, Imin. 38|sec. BRISBANE TURF CLUB’S CUP. Rec. 5.5 p.m. Brisbane, June 15. At the Queensland Turf Club’s meeting'the chief result was: — ALBION CUP. ROWLADDIE,' 7.9 (Baker) 1 AERO’ FORCE, 7.5 (Conquest) .... 2 FREEBOOTER, 10.2 (Brennan) .... 3 Twelve started. Won by four lengths, with a neck between second and third. Time-, 2min. 14sec.
